1. The Fundamental Conversion: Understanding the Ratio



At the heart of this conversion lies a simple yet powerful ratio: 1 meter is approximately equal to 3.28084 feet. This isn't just a random number plucked from thin air; it's the result of meticulously defined standards. The meter, originally based on a fraction of the Earth's meridian, and the foot, with its historical roots in human body proportions, have distinct origins. Yet, through careful measurement and standardization, we have established this reliable conversion factor. Think of it as a bridge connecting two distinct measurement worlds.

This means that converting 40 meters to feet is a straightforward multiplication: 40 meters 3.28084 feet/meter ≈ 131.23 feet. However, the precision offered by this calculation often exceeds real-world needs. For most practical purposes, rounding to 131 feet is perfectly acceptable, offering a manageable level of accuracy without sacrificing practicality. Imagine you're planning a 40-meter garden fence – a 1-inch difference is unlikely to impact the project's success.

1. What is the exact conversion factor for meters to feet, and why are there variations? The exact conversion factor is based on the official definitions of the meter and the foot, which can vary slightly depending on the standards used (e.g., US Survey foot vs. International foot). Variations arise from the historical development and differing standardization efforts of both systems.

2. How does the conversion process change if we're dealing with larger distances, such as kilometers to miles? The principle remains the same: you'll need a conversion factor (1 kilometer ≈ 0.621371 miles). The calculation becomes more significant in scale, but the underlying methodology remains consistent.

3. What are the potential sources of error in meter-to-foot conversions, and how can they be minimized? Errors can stem from rounding, using outdated or imprecise conversion factors, or inaccuracies in the original measurements. Using the most up-to-date conversion factors, carrying extra significant figures during calculations, and double-checking results can minimize these errors.

5. Beyond simple linear measurements, how does the conversion of units apply to area and volume calculations? Converting areas or volumes requires squaring or cubing the linear conversion factor, respectively. For example, converting 40 square meters to square feet requires multiplying by (3.28084)^2. This principle extends to all higher-dimensional measurements.
